Connecting hospitality operators with dedicated industry suppliers and specialists
- Al-Farid, 3 Cathedral Yard, Exeter EX1 1HJ, United Kingdom
- +44 1392 494444
- [email protected]
- https://www.alfaridrestaurant.co.uk
Connecting hospitality operators with dedicated industry suppliers and specialists
Copyright © Suite 6 t/a Find a Restaurant